In their thrilling 2-2 draw against Croatia, Albania’s Jasir Asani caught our attention not only with his assist but also with his unique footwear. Asani wore custom Super Mario Bros.-themed boots, with each foot featuring a different character from the popular video game.

Meanwhile, other players like Austria’s Romano Schmid and Spain’s Lamine Yamal have been adding personal touches to their boots, with Schmid sporting his initials and Yamal displaying his heritage by including the flags of Morocco and Equatorial Guinea.

But not everyone feels the need to switch up their style. Germany’s Toni Kroos has been wearing the same model of boots for the past decade, and it seems to be working for him as he continues to dominate on the field.
